Scientific Purpose/Goals: Deploy ADCP to collect offshore waves, currents and water depth data.

Vehicle(s): None

Start Port/Location: Madeira Beach, FL

End Port/Location: Madeira Beach, FL

Start Date: 2017-09-06

End Date: 2017-09-06

Equipment Used: Acoustic Doppler Current Profiler (ADCP)

Information to be Derived: Mean wave parameters (height, period, direction), mean currents (magnitude and direction), and mean water depth.

Summary of Activity and Data Gathered: Deployed ADCP to collect offshore waves, currents and water depth data.
